The State of California, through Placer County, has awarded funding under the Community Care Expansion (CCE) program to support residential adult and senior care facilities. The program aims to promote sustainability and address gaps in long-term care by providing Operating Subsidy Payments and Capital Projects funds for critical repairs and upgrades. The funds are allocated to qualifying facilities within Placer County to prevent closures and support residents, including those at risk of homelessness. The award was part of a Request for Applications process, with the bid awarded on May 27, 2025.

Description

The State of California has established a Community Care Expansion (CCE) program to promote the sustainability of residential adult and senior care facilities and to address historic gaps in the long-term care continuum. Funding is available through the State’s CCE Preservation Fund to preserve and avoid the closure of licensed residential adult and senior care facilities serving applicants or recipients of SSI/SSP or CAPI, including those at risk of homelessness. The funds are divided into Operating Subsidy Payments for existing facilities and Capital Projects funds for critical repairs or upgrades. Placer County has obtained CCE funding for distribution to qualifying facilities within the county.
